Bipolar Disorder therapists in Columbia, South Carolina Statistics

Bipolar Disorder therapists in Columbia, South Carolina average 18 years of experience and charge around $203 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(80%), Solution-Focused Brief Therapy (SFBT) (48%), and Person-Centered Therapy (Rogerian) (46%).
